The lucky residents and frequent visitors of Lake Keowee know that one of its
most stunning features is its sparkling nearby lake. Lake Jocassee encompasses
7,500 acres and surrounded by mountains, waterfalls, and 75 miles of shoreline.
Located within the Jocassee Gorges Wilderness and known for its deep and pristine
waters, this lake offers not only outstanding boating and fishing but beautiful
steep cliffs and natural grandeur. Take a guided tour of its waterfalls, hike
in the lush wooded Devils Fork State Park, or hop on a jet ski and explore the
lake’s many inlets. You’ll spend hours making memories at this treasured spot.
On the east side of Lake Keowee is Table Rock State Park, offering the most challenging
hiking trails in the state park system. Get away to a cabin in the mountains for
a weekend retreat or enjoy fishing at Pinnacle Lake and Lake Oolenoy. Encompassing
3,083 acres, this park is close enough for frequent day trips. Plenty of rustic
cabins await you when you feel the urge to show off the scenery for friends and
family.
Not far from Lake Keowee is Caesar’s Head State Park, known for its spectacular
waterfalls. Bring your camera to capture mountain vistas, blue lakes, and abundant
wildflowers. You’ll never have to go far to get away from it all! Oconee State
Park, on the west side of Lake Keowee, is a popular place to unwind. With hiking,
camping, and two small lakes, this area offers a quick getaway. Of course, when
